Mandii B aka Full Court Pumps is the host of Whoreible Decisions Podcast. Her show ranks in the top 1% of all podcast in regards to listenership. She left her job as an accountant at one of the largest accounting firms in the world last year to become a full-time podcaster when she matched her annual corporate salary from her show in the first 5 months of the year. In episode 56 we teamed up with Mandii to cover one of our most requested topics, how to start and make money from a podcast. Mandii broke down her show’s revenue model step by step and explained how they brought in a quarter-million dollars last year. She explained the touring process, patreon, ads and more. She also gave a look into the politics and inner workings of being on the top podcast network. The World of podcasting has a lot more millionaires to make in the next few years.
